A Texas ... WebA psychologist studies the mind and behavior. The average day of a psychologist varies depending on their specific role and where they work. For example, a psychologist working in a hospital may spend their days diagnosing clients, performing psychotherapy treatments, and completing various administrative tasks.

WebMar 3, 2024 · In order to become a psychologist you need to: Earn a bachelor's degree. Complete a master's degree. Consider gaining practice experience. Pursue a doctorate degree. Complete clinical training in psychology. Pass the national psychology exam. Obtain licensure. Select a preferred work environment.
